
Puducherry: DMK not to support no-confidence motion against Speaker, says R. Siva
The HinduThe principal Opposition party in Puducherry, Dravida Munnetra Kazhagam, has taken a stand different from that of its ally Congress by deciding not to extend support to the two Independents to move a no-confidence motion against Speaker R. Selvam in the Puducherry Assembly. Addressing a press conference here on Tuesday, Opposition leader and DMK convenor R. Siva said the party leadership has felt it politically not prudent to support the decision of the two legislators to move a no-confidence motion. Last week, Independent MLAs, Nehru alias Kuppusamy and P. Angalane, had submitted separate notices to move a no-confidence motion against the Speaker for allegedly breaking parliamentary rules and conventions by participating in party functions. The Congress did not consult us before making the announcement.” When asked whether DMK will change its stand on supporting the no-confidence motion if Congress legislators submit a notice for moving a resolution against the Speaker, Mr. Siva said if such a scenario arises, the party would take a decision after consulting the leadership.
